C/C Composites is the common name for Carbon fiber reinforced carbon composites or CFC. It is an advanced material made of thin carbon fibers and matrix binder together; it creates a composite of highly durable materials for high temperature and friction applications.
The basic manufacturing principles of the C/C composite involve fibers and a matrix going through several impregnations and heat treatment cycles. Once these steps are complete, graphitization is the final process, leaving you with a C/C Composite material.
